I typically get there early so my house feels is the same cost as our VIP. So the way I mentally frame it is, I do one VIP for them, and the rest I get a cut of. (50 or 60% depending on the day of the week.) I’ve still walked out with money every night except two in the 6 months I’ve been here. My average is $400-800 a night. Objectively, keeping less than half of what I make the house seems like robbery. It’s worth it FOR ME because it’s still more than what I’ve made at any civ job. But if you’re coming from somewhere that you pay a flat rate, set your own prices and keep everything you make, you might get frustrated dancing here lol.

Also would like to add that unless you’re working at a stage heavy club, you’re not going to make much money from having your tits out on stage, even when they do tip. Most of your money will come from private dances, so if you’re uncomfortable having strangers LOOK at your boobs, really think about if you’re comfortable with strangers trying to touch/ lick your naked tits. No, you don’t have to allow that but men will try to cross your boundaries and you have to be assertive enough to hold them.

When I get cashed out at the end of the night we have to sign this sheet to confirm we received our cut. The sheet lists everyone’s totals for the shift so it’s easy to see who made what (minus tips).

I try not to look bc I will get in my head if I start comparing myself

The anxiety hasn’t gone away for me lol. That’s why I’ve kept my day job. It can be hard doing both. In fact, when I picked up dancing I started having attendance issues at my day job bc I would try to work the night before certain shifts and then would oversleep. I cut down on the dancing to make sure I was taking care of my day job.

I do get monetary FOMO when I’m scheduled a Sunday morning civ shift and have to miss out on a Saturday night at the club. And sometimes I do entertain the thought of dancing “full time” but for me, I’d rather have some flow of guaranteed money, even if it’s potentially less than I would be making if I could dance more often. And I feel like it helps me make the most of my dance shifts bc I have less anxiety going in bc I know everything I make is supplemental.

It’s just a trade off. Guaranteed money vs (potentially) more income. Only you can decide what’s right for you. Personally, I choose peace of mind.
